Navigating the Path to Clarity: Understanding ADHD Medication Titration
Attention-Deficit/Hyperactivity Disorder (ADHD) is a complicated neurodevelopmental condition that impacts millions of children and grownups worldwide. While behavior modification and lifestyle modifications play essential functions in management, pharmacotherapy stays a foundation of treatment for lots of. Nevertheless, unlike a basic prescription for an antibiotic where the dose is mainly determined by body weight, ADHD medication follows a special scientific procedure called titration.
The titration process is a purposeful, detailed method of adjusting medication dosage to determine the most reliable quantity with the fewest negative effects. It is an extremely individualized journey, acknowledging that 2 people with comparable signs and body types may respond really in a different way to the precise very same dose.
What is Medication Titration?
In the context of ADHD, titration is the duration during which a health care company and a patient work together to find the "therapeutic window." This window is the exact dosage range where the medication provides optimum sign relief while lessening adverse impacts.
The objective is not to reach the greatest possible dose, however rather the least expensive reliable dosage. Due to the fact that ADHD medications-- particularly stimulants-- connect with neurotransmitters like dopamine and norepinephrine in the brain, the "optimum" dose is figured out by an individual's distinct neurochemistry and metabolic process rather than their height or weight.
Why Titration is Necessary
The requirement of titration comes from the high degree of variability in how individuals metabolize ADHD medications. Elements affecting this irregularity consist of:
- Genetic Factors: Variations in liver enzymes (such as the CYP450 system) impact how rapidly or gradually a body breaks down a compound.
- Gastrointestinal Health: The rate of absorption in the stomach can alter the medication's efficacy.
- Co-occurring Conditions: Presence of anxiety, anxiety, or sleep conditions can mask or exacerbate the impacts of ADHD medication.
- Hormone Fluctuations: For many individuals, especially women, hormone modifications throughout the month can affect how reliable a medication feels.
Table 1: Common Classes of ADHD Medications
| Medication Category | Common Examples | Main Mechanism of Action | Normal Titration Speed |
|---|---|---|---|
| Stimulants (Methylphenidate) | Ritalin, Concerta, Daytrana | Blocks reuptake of dopamine and norepinephrine. | Fast (Weekly modifications) |
| Stimulants (Amphetamines) | Adderall, Vyvanse, Mydayis | Boosts release and blocks reuptake of dopamine/norepinephrine. | Fast (Weekly adjustments) |
| Non-Stimulants (SNRIs) | Strattera (Atomoxetine) | Increases norepinephrine levels in the brain. | Sluggish (2-- 4 weeks to see effects) |
| Alpha-2 Agonists | Intuniv (Guanfacine), Kapvay | Strengthens signals in the prefrontal cortex. | Moderate (1-- 2 weeks) |
The Step-by-Step Titration Process
The procedure of titration is a marathon, not a sprint. It generally follows a structured scientific course to guarantee client security and data-driven decision-making.
1. Standard Assessment
Before starting medication, a clinician develops a standard. This involves recording the frequency and intensity of symptoms like distractibility, impulsivity, and restlessness. Physical health standards, such as high blood pressure, heart rate, and weight, are also recorded.
2. The Starting Dose
A clinician typically begins the patient on the most affordable possible dose of the chosen medication. During this phase, the client may not feel any substantial changes. The purpose of the beginning dose is to check for instant level of sensitivity or allergic reactions rather than immediate symptom control.
3. Tracking and Data Collection
The individual (or their caretaker) is charged with tracking the medication's results daily. This consists of noting when the medication "starts," when it "uses off," and any changes in state of mind or physical feeling.
4. Incremental Adjustments
If the starting dose is well-tolerated however signs persist, the doctor will increase the dose incrementally. This normally takes place every one to 2 weeks for stimulants. For non-stimulants, the increments may happen every couple of weeks, as these medications need more time to build up in the system.
5. Reaching the Maintenance Phase
The titration procedure concludes when the "sweet spot" is found. At this moment, the client experiences a considerable reduction in ADHD symptoms, and any negative effects are either non-existent or manageable.
Keeping An Eye On Symptoms and Side Effects
Information is the most valuable tool throughout the titration duration. Clinicians frequently advise utilizing standardized rating scales (such as the Vanderbilt or ASRS) integrated with an everyday log.
Secret Indicators to Monitor:
- Focus and Attention: Is the specific able to remain on task longer?
- Internal Restlessness: Is there a reduction in "brain fog" or the feeling of being "driven by a motor"?
- Psychological Regulation: Is the specific less susceptible to abrupt outbursts or aggravation?
- Physical Side Effects: Changes in appetite, sleep patterns, or heart rate.

Common Challenges During Titration
The path to discovering the right dosage is hardly ever direct. Patients and clinicians frequently experience obstacles that need patience and scientific insight.
- The "Rebound" Effect: As medication wears away, some individuals experience a momentary worsening of signs or irritation. This is called a crash or rebound. It might suggest that the dose is appropriate but the delivery system (short-acting vs. long-acting) requires change.
- Short-term Side Effects: Some adverse effects, like mild headaches or jitters, frequently disappear after the first week of a brand-new dosage. It is necessary not to abandon a dosage too early if the adverse effects are moderate and reducing.
- The "Honey-Moon" Period: Sometimes a brand-new medication works exceptionally well for three days, then the result appears to vanish. This frequently suggests the body is adjusting and a slightly greater dose might be needed for long-lasting stability.
Frequently Asked Questions (FAQ)
How long does the titration process typically take?

Why does my child require a higher dosage than I do, although I am larger?
Metabolic process plays a bigger role than body mass in ADHD medication. Children often have quicker metabolic rates than grownups, meaning their bodies process and eliminate the medication more rapidly, sometimes requiring a greater or more regular dose.
Can I skip doses throughout titration?
It is normally recommended to take the medication regularly during the titration phase. Avoiding days makes it hard for the clinician to identify if a dosage is truly effective or if the "good days" are merely a coincidence.
What if I reach the maximum dose and still feel nothing?
If a specific reaches the ceiling of a medication's dosage variety without improvement, the clinician will likely switch to a different class of medication (e.g., changing from a methylphenidate to an amphetamine) or check out the possibility of a co-occurring condition.
Do I need to titrate once again if I switch brands?
Often, yes. While the active ingredient in generic and brand-name medications is the exact same, the "fillers" and delivery mechanisms (how the tablet dissolves) can differ, which may change how the body takes in the drug.
